About The Position

Lowell Community Charter Public School (LCCPS) seeks an enthusiastic and dependable Middle School Strings (Violin) Program Assistant Instructor to support our after-school performing arts programming. This role is ideal for college-level music students or emerging educators interested in gaining hands-on teaching experience in a dynamic urban school setting. The Assistant Instructor will work closely with the Performing Arts Director to support instruction, small-group rehearsals, student engagement, classroom management, and program logistics during twice-weekly after-school sessions held on campus.

Requirements

  • Current college student or recent graduate majoring in music performance, music education, or a related field
  • Strong violin proficiency required
  • Ability to follow instructional direction and collaborate as part of a teaching team
  • Dependable and punctual for twice-weekly sessions
  • Background check clearance required

Responsibilities

  • Support & lead instruction during after-school violin classes and rehearsals
  • Work with small groups or individual students on technique, posture, rhythm, tone production, and repertoire
  • Assist with tuning instruments and basic equipment setup/breakdown
  • Reinforce rehearsal expectations and positive student behavior
  • Help track attendance and student participation
  • Support performances, showcases, and culminating events as scheduled
  • Communicate professionally with staff and students
  • Model professionalism, reliability, and enthusiasm for music education
